- Johannesburg
- Job Type: Permanent
-
Posted: 29 Jan 2026
8 Days left
- Johannesburg
- Job Type: Permanent
-
Posted: 29 Jan 2026
8 Days left
- Westville
- Job Type: Permanent
-
Posted: 29 Jan 2026
8 Days left
- Durban
- Job Type: Permanent
-
Posted: 28 Jan 2026
9 Days left
